PE14 9RG lies on Chestnut Avenue in Welney, Wisbech. PE14 9RG is located in the Upwell & Delph electoral ward, within the local authority district of King's Lynn and West Norfolk and the English Parliamentary constituency of South West Norfolk. The Sub Integrated Care Board (ICB) Location is NHS Norfolk and Waveney ICB - 26A and the police force is Norfolk. This postcode has been in use since January 1980.
